FORM{ margin:0px; }
.button{ font-size:10px; letter-spacing:1; background-color:#D8E8F0; border:1px dashed #D8E8F0; }
TEXTAREA{ font-size:11px; width:580; height:400; }

IMG{ margin:2px 5px 6px 3px; }

.Count{
background-image:url(http://www.quiste.net/count/diary_dayx.cgi?gif);
background-position:460px 6px;
background-repeat:no-repeat;
}

/* calender */
h1{ margin:0px; }
.calendar TD{ font-size:11px; text-align:right; }
.cyear{ font-size:16px; }

/* mini calender */
.calendar_row{ font-size:11px; }
.calendar_row A{ color:#000000; text-decoration:underline; }
.csat{ color:#6868FF; }
.csat A{ color:#6868FF; }
.csun{ color:#FF6868; }
.csun A{ color:#FF6868; }

/* memo */
.Memo{
font-size:11px;
background-position:99% 6px;
background-repeat:no-repeat;
}

.tyear{ font-weight:bold; }
.tmonth{ width:30; vertical-align:top; }
.gtable TD{ vertical-align:top; height:90; width:90; }

.I{ width:150; }

/* category */
.Ct{ width:80; border:1px dashed #D8E8F0;
margin:-1 3 0 0px; padding:3 0 0 5px; }

/* memo */
TABLE.dq6{  }
TABLE.dq6 TD{ font-size:11px; border:1px solid #7C7C7C; text-align:center; }

